Title:
[imap] moving a folder results in its deletion
Status in “evolution” package in Ubuntu:
New
Bug description:
Steps to reproduce:
1. drag a folder onto another folder
Expected results:
1. folder is moved with its contents to be a subfolder of the folder that it
was dropped on
Current results:
1. the folder in question gets deleted along with its contents
